What Specifically Is a Car Accident Lawyer?
A car accident lawyer is a licensed legal professional who focuses specifically on cases involving motor vehicle collisions. Unlike a general practice attorney, a car accident lawyer builds specialized knowledge in tort law, insurance regulations, and accident reconstruction. That focused background is a real advantage for clients filing injury claims.
Mechanically, the job of a car accident lawyer spans a range of critical functions. First, they gather and preserve evidence — crash scene photos, black-box data, hospital bills, and expert opinions. Then they determine the complete value of your damages, including future medical costs and intangible losses such as emotional distress. Finally, they advocate firmly with insurance carriers — and litigate in court if negotiations break down.

The Car Accident Lawyer Procedure Step by Step
- Your First Meeting With Us — You sit down with a car accident lawyer to understand what happened and who was involved. This is a no-pressure conversation — just an honest assessment at what your legal options are.
- Building the Case File — After you sign on as a client, our staff takes action without delay collecting the police report, medical records, photographs, and witness information. The earlier this begins the more evidence survives.
- Medical Documentation and Damage Calculation — A car accident lawyer reviews your treatment records carefully to document both current and future medical needs. Economic damages like lost wages and medical expenses are paired with intangible harms like emotional distress and loss of enjoyment.
- Making the Formal Claim — Our attorneys draft a detailed demand letter establishing fault, describing damages, and demanding a specific amount. Then we engage the insurer directly — no rushed or inadequate settlement gets our approval without your informed consent.
- Filing Suit If Necessary — Should negotiations hit a wall, our car accident lawyer takes your case to court in the right local court. This step signals to the insurer that we are serious about recovering what you're owed.
- Building the Trial Record — We gather additional evidence through formal legal channels to sharpen every argument. Expert testimony often proves decisive at this stage.
- Resolution — Settlement or Verdict — The vast majority of car accident cases settle — but when they don't, we're ready to go the distance. Regardless of how the case closes, our aim is the maximum compensation you're entitled to.

How long does the car accident lawyer legal case typically take?
Case duration depends on several factors according to the nature of your injuries and how quickly the other side engages. Uncomplicated situations with cooperative insurers can close within 90 to 180 days. Disputes involving serious injuries or contested fault often extend beyond 12 months — but our office communicates regularly so you're never in the dark.

How is liability determined in a Nevada car accident case?
Nevada law allocates fault between parties — meaning you can still recover damages even if you were partially at fault unless you are found more than half responsible. The amount you receive reflects your degree of responsibility. A car accident lawyer analyzes the evidence with this standard in mind to limit any reduction to your compensation.
What kinds of damages can a car accident lawyer help me recover?
Injured clients may be entitled to multiple types of compensation. Hard-dollar damages covering emergency care, surgery, physical therapy, and income replacement form the core of most claims. Intangible harms including anxiety, grief, and diminished daily experience matter just as much legally. Where the crash resulted from willful disregard for safety, the court may award additional punitive amounts.
